## What is the Integration of Hybrid DeFi Architectures?

Hybrid DeFi architectures combine decentralized on-chain protocols with centralized off-chain execution venues to optimize capital efficiency in crypto derivatives. By leveraging the transparency of blockchain for clearing and settlement while utilizing centralized order books for high-frequency trading, these frameworks bridge the gap between traditional market microstructure and permissionless finance. This dual-layer approach allows traders to maintain non-custodial control over collateral while accessing the sub-millisecond latency required for effective options pricing and delta hedging.

## What is the Liquidity of Hybrid DeFi Architectures?

Concentrated market depth is achieved by routing order flow through integrated settlement layers that mitigate the slippage inherent in purely automated market makers. These architectures allow institutional participants to aggregate fragmented supply across multiple chains into a unified margin environment. Through the strategic use of cross-margin accounts, the system reduces liquidation risk and enhances the overall stability of derivatives portfolios during periods of high volatility.

## What is the Automation of Hybrid DeFi Architectures?

Execution logic within these systems relies on smart contract triggers that enforce pre-defined collateralization requirements and autonomous margin calls. Sophisticated algorithmic strategies interface with on-chain oracles to update Greeks and strike prices in real time, ensuring that the parity between synthetic exposures and underlying assets remains precise. By automating the lifecycle of complex financial instruments, the architecture minimizes human error and reduces the overhead associated with manual risk management.
